Ir para conteúdo
Fórum Script Brasil

caiognr

Membros
  • Total de itens

    14
  • Registro em

  • Última visita

Posts postados por caiognr

  1. Boa tarde galera!

    Estou fechando um projeto e o cliente quer fazer um multi-media(cd-rom) que tenha um sistema de busca em um banco de dados no flash...Procurei em livros forums e em um monte de lugar porém não achei nada a respeito(banco de dados em cd)...Pensei em usar XML, porém não sei se ele funciona sem net...

    Gostaria que vocês me ajudassem!

    Muito obrigado e Falow!!!

  2. Boa noite a todos.

    Estou programando um site e empaquei em algo aparentemente muito simples, nunca tive tal problema, vamos a ele. Eu fiz um script que insere dados de um form em 1 tabela no banco de dados, dentre os campos há um que o usuário do site escreverá o texto de uma matéria, sendo assim eu coloquei um text área com quebra de linha:

    duvida_figura.jpg

    porém quando eu vou exibir os dados, esse texto é exibido em uma única linha.

    Creio que o problema esteja na inserção dos dados mas me parece estar correto o código:

    $titulo_col_1 = $_POST['titulo_col_1'];
            $col_1 = $_POST['col_1'];
            $cod_colunista = $_POST['cod_colunista'];
            $data = date("y.m.d");
                
                $insere = "INSERT INTO colunas ( cod_colunista , titulo , coluna , data ) VALUES ( '$cod_colunista' , '$titulo_col_1', '$col_1' , '$data' )";
                mysql_select_db($database_conexao, $conexao);
      $resultado = mysql_query($insere, $conexao) or die(mysql_error());
                if($resultado = TRUE){
                    header("Location: sucesso.html");
                
            }
    

    Preciso muito da ajuda de vocês e agradeço desde já!

  3. Eu estou construindo um site de uma imobiliaria o qual tem uma página de inserção de registros. Gostaria de saber como faço para a foto ser inserida corretamente pois eu não estou conseguindo exibi-la posteriormente, é feito o upload para o servidor porém acho que as informações que vão para o campo foto são insuficientes para localizar a foto na pasta do servidor.

    Suegue o código:

      
    
    <?php
    function GetSQLValueString($theValue, $theType, $theDefinedValue = "", $theNotDefinedValue = "") 
    {
     $theValue = (!get_magic_quotes_gpc()) ? addslashes($theValue) : $theValue;
    
     switch ($theType) {
       case "text":
         $theValue = ($theValue != "") ? "'" . $theValue . "'" : "NULL";
         break;    
       case "long":
       case "int":
         $theValue = ($theValue != "") ? intval($theValue) : "NULL";
         break;
       case "double":
         $theValue = ($theValue != "") ? "'" . doubleval($theValue) . "'" : "NULL";
         break;
       case "date":
         $theValue = ($theValue != "") ? "'" . $theValue . "'" : "NULL";
         break;
       case "defined":
         $theValue = ($theValue != "") ? $theDefinedValue : $theNotDefinedValue;
         break;
     }
     return $theValue;
    }
    
    $editFormAction = $_SERVER['PHP_SELF'];
    if (isset($_SERVER['QUERY_STRING'])) {
     $editFormAction .= "?" . htmlentities($_SERVER['QUERY_STRING']);
    }
    
    if ((isset($_POST["MM_insert"])) && ($_POST["MM_insert"] == "form1")) {
     $arquivo = $_FILES["foto"];
    $arquivo_nome = $arquivo["name"];
    $endereco = "c:\inetpub\wwwroot\perfilimoveisonline\dados";
    $tudo = $endereco + $arquivo_nome; 
     $insertSQL = sprintf("INSERT INTO imoveis (codneg, cod_tipo, local_cod, Área, Condomínio, Cidade, Bairro, Dormitórios, Valor, Detalhes, foto) VALUES (%s, %s, %s, %s, %s, %s, %s, %s, %s, %s, '$arquivo_nome')",
                          GetSQLValueString($_POST['codneg'], "int"),
                          GetSQLValueString($_POST['cod_tipo'], "int"),
                          GetSQLValueString($_POST['local_cod'], "int"),
                          GetSQLValueString($_POST['Área'], "text"),
                          GetSQLValueString($_POST['Condominio'], "text"),
                          GetSQLValueString($_POST['Cidade'], "text"),
                          GetSQLValueString($_POST['Bairro'], "text"),
                          GetSQLValueString($_POST['Dormitorios'], "int"),
                          GetSQLValueString($_POST['Valor'], "text"),
                          GetSQLValueString($_POST['Detalhes'], "text"));
                         
    set_time_limit(0);
    $diretorio = "c:\inetpub\wwwroot\perfilimoveisonline\dados";
    $id_arquivo = "foto";
    $nome_arquivo = $_FILES[$id_arquivo]["name"];
    $arquivo_temporario = $_FILES[$id_arquivo]["tmp_name"];
    move_uploaded_file($arquivo_temporario, "$diretorio/$nome_arquivo");
                          
    
     mysql_select_db($database_conexao, $conexao);
     $Result1 = mysql_query($insertSQL, $conexao) or die(mysql_error());
    
     $insertGoTo = "SUCESSO.PHP";
     if (isset($_SERVER['QUERY_STRING'])) {
       $insertGoTo .= (strpos($insertGoTo, '?')) ? "&" : "?";
       $insertGoTo .= $_SERVER['QUERY_STRING'];
     }
     header(sprintf("Location: %s", $insertGoTo));
    }
    ?>
    
    
    especificamente:
    if ((isset($_POST["MM_insert"])) && ($_POST["MM_insert"] == "form1")) {
     $arquivo = $_FILES["foto"];
    $arquivo_nome = $arquivo["name"];
    $endereco = "c:\inetpub\wwwroot\perfilimoveisonline\dados";
    $tudo = $endereco + $arquivo_nome; 
     $insertSQL = sprintf("INSERT INTO imoveis (codneg, cod_tipo, local_cod, Área, Condomínio, Cidade, Bairro, Dormitórios, Valor, Detalhes, foto) VALUES (%s, %s, %s, %s, %s, %s, %s, %s, %s, %s, '$arquivo_nome')",
                          GetSQLValueString($_POST['codneg'], "int"),
                          GetSQLValueString($_POST['cod_tipo'], "int"),
                          GetSQLValueString($_POST['local_cod'], "int"),
                          GetSQLValueString($_POST['Área'], "text"),
                          GetSQLValueString($_POST['Condominio'], "text"),
                          GetSQLValueString($_POST['Cidade'], "text"),
                          GetSQLValueString($_POST['Bairro'], "text"),
                          GetSQLValueString($_POST['Dormitorios'], "int"),
                          GetSQLValueString($_POST['Valor'], "text"),
                          GetSQLValueString($_POST['Detalhes'], "text"));
                         
    set_time_limit(0);
    $diretorio = "c:\inetpub\wwwroot\perfilimoveisonline\dados";
    $id_arquivo = "foto";
    $nome_arquivo = $_FILES[$id_arquivo]["name"];
    $arquivo_temporario = $_FILES[$id_arquivo]["tmp_name"];
    move_uploaded_file($arquivo_temporario, "$diretorio/$nome_arquivo");
                          
    
     mysql_select_db($database_conexao, $conexao);
     $Result1 = mysql_query($insertSQL, $conexao) or die(mysql_error());
    
     $insertGoTo = "SUCESSO.PHP";
     if (isset($_SERVER['QUERY_STRING'])) {
       $insertGoTo .= (strpos($insertGoTo, '?')) ? "&" : "?";
       $insertGoTo .= $_SERVER['QUERY_STRING'];
     }
     header(sprintf("Location: %s", $insertGoTo));
    } 
    
    
    
    

    Valeu!

  4. Boa tarde pessoal,

    Eu criei um sistema que envia um arquivo para uma pasta no servidor e nome para o banco de dados. Porém eu queria saber como eu faço para mandar junto com o nome da foto o caminha físico, num único campo.

    Segue o código:

    <?php
    function GetSQLValueString($theValue, $theType, $theDefinedValue = "", $theNotDefinedValue = "") 
    {
      $theValue = (!get_magic_quotes_gpc()) ? addslashes($theValue) : $theValue;
    
      switch ($theType) {
        case "text":
          $theValue = ($theValue != "") ? "'" . $theValue . "'" : "NULL";
          break;    
        case "long":
        case "int":
          $theValue = ($theValue != "") ? intval($theValue) : "NULL";
          break;
        case "double":
          $theValue = ($theValue != "") ? "'" . doubleval($theValue) . "'" : "NULL";
          break;
        case "date":
          $theValue = ($theValue != "") ? "'" . $theValue . "'" : "NULL";
          break;
        case "defined":
          $theValue = ($theValue != "") ? $theDefinedValue : $theNotDefinedValue;
          break;
      }
      return $theValue;
    }
    
    $editFormAction = $_SERVER['PHP_SELF'];
    if (isset($_SERVER['QUERY_STRING'])) {
      $editFormAction .= "?" . htmlentities($_SERVER['QUERY_STRING']);
    }
    
    if ((isset($_POST["MM_insert"])) && ($_POST["MM_insert"] == "form1")) {
      $arquivo = $_FILES["Foto"];
    $arquivo_nome = $arquivo["name"];
    $endereco = "c:\inetpub\wwwroot\perfilimoveisonline\dados";
    $tudo = $endereco + $arquivo_nome; 
      $insertSQL = sprintf("INSERT INTO imoveis (codneg, cod_tipo, local_cod, Área, Condomínio, Cidade, Bairro, Dormitórios, Valor, Detalhes, foto) VALUES (%s, %s, %s, %s, %s, %s, %s, %s, %s, %s, '$arquivo_nome')",
                           GetSQLValueString($_POST['codneg'], "int"),
                           GetSQLValueString($_POST['cod_tipo'], "int"),
                           GetSQLValueString($_POST['local_cod'], "int"),
                           GetSQLValueString($_POST['Área'], "int"),
                           GetSQLValueString($_POST['Condomínio'], "text"),
                           GetSQLValueString($_POST['Cidade'], "text"),
                           GetSQLValueString($_POST['Bairro'], "text"),
                           GetSQLValueString($_POST['Dormitórios'], "int"),
                           GetSQLValueString($_POST['Valor'], "double"),
                           GetSQLValueString($_POST['Detalhes'], "text"));
                          
    set_time_limit(0);
    $diretorio = "c:\inetpub\wwwroot\perfilimoveisonline\dados";
    $id_arquivo = "foto";
    $nome_arquivo = $_FILES[$id_arquivo]["name"];
    $arquivo_temporario = $_FILES[$id_arquivo]["tmp_name"];
    move_uploaded_file($arquivo_temporario, "$diretorio/$nome_arquivo");
                           
    
      mysql_select_db($database_conexao, $conexao);
      $Result1 = mysql_query($insertSQL, $conexao) or die(mysql_error());
    
      $insertGoTo = "SUCESSO.PHP";
      if (isset($_SERVER['QUERY_STRING'])) {
        $insertGoTo .= (strpos($insertGoTo, '?')) ? "&" : "?";
        $insertGoTo .= $_SERVER['QUERY_STRING'];
      }
      header(sprintf("Location: %s", $insertGoTo));
    }
    ?>

    Valeu! smile.gif

  5. Boa tarde pessoal,

    Eu criei um sistema que envia um arquivo para uma pasta no servidor e nome para o banco de dados. Porém eu queria saber como eu faço para mandar junto com o nome da foto o caminha físico, num único campo.

    Segue o código:

    <?php
    function GetSQLValueString($theValue, $theType, $theDefinedValue = "", $theNotDefinedValue = "") 
    {
      $theValue = (!get_magic_quotes_gpc()) ? addslashes($theValue) : $theValue;
    
      switch ($theType) {
        case "text":
          $theValue = ($theValue != "") ? "'" . $theValue . "'" : "NULL";
          break;    
        case "long":
        case "int":
          $theValue = ($theValue != "") ? intval($theValue) : "NULL";
          break;
        case "double":
          $theValue = ($theValue != "") ? "'" . doubleval($theValue) . "'" : "NULL";
          break;
        case "date":
          $theValue = ($theValue != "") ? "'" . $theValue . "'" : "NULL";
          break;
        case "defined":
          $theValue = ($theValue != "") ? $theDefinedValue : $theNotDefinedValue;
          break;
      }
      return $theValue;
    }
    
    $editFormAction = $_SERVER['PHP_SELF'];
    if (isset($_SERVER['QUERY_STRING'])) {
      $editFormAction .= "?" . htmlentities($_SERVER['QUERY_STRING']);
    }
    
    if ((isset($_POST["MM_insert"])) && ($_POST["MM_insert"] == "form1")) {
      $arquivo = $_FILES["Foto"];
    $arquivo_nome = $arquivo["name"];
    $endereco = "c:\inetpub\wwwroot\perfilimoveisonline\dados";
    $tudo = $endereco + $arquivo_nome; 
      $insertSQL = sprintf("INSERT INTO imoveis (codneg, cod_tipo, local_cod, Área, Condomínio, Cidade, Bairro, Dormitórios, Valor, Detalhes, foto) VALUES (%s, %s, %s, %s, %s, %s, %s, %s, %s, %s, '$arquivo_nome')",
                           GetSQLValueString($_POST['codneg'], "int"),
                           GetSQLValueString($_POST['cod_tipo'], "int"),
                           GetSQLValueString($_POST['local_cod'], "int"),
                           GetSQLValueString($_POST['Área'], "int"),
                           GetSQLValueString($_POST['Condomínio'], "text"),
                           GetSQLValueString($_POST['Cidade'], "text"),
                           GetSQLValueString($_POST['Bairro'], "text"),
                           GetSQLValueString($_POST['Dormitórios'], "int"),
                           GetSQLValueString($_POST['Valor'], "double"),
                           GetSQLValueString($_POST['Detalhes'], "text"));
                          
    set_time_limit(0);
    $diretorio = "c:\inetpub\wwwroot\perfilimoveisonline\dados";
    $id_arquivo = "foto";
    $nome_arquivo = $_FILES[$id_arquivo]["name"];
    $arquivo_temporario = $_FILES[$id_arquivo]["tmp_name"];
    move_uploaded_file($arquivo_temporario, "$diretorio/$nome_arquivo");
                           
    
      mysql_select_db($database_conexao, $conexao);
      $Result1 = mysql_query($insertSQL, $conexao) or die(mysql_error());
    
      $insertGoTo = "SUCESSO.PHP";
      if (isset($_SERVER['QUERY_STRING'])) {
        $insertGoTo .= (strpos($insertGoTo, '?')) ? "&" : "?";
        $insertGoTo .= $_SERVER['QUERY_STRING'];
      }
      header(sprintf("Location: %s", $insertGoTo));
    }
    ?>

  6. Boa noite pessoal.

    Gostaria de uma ajuda, novamente.

    Estou aprendendo a programar em php, comprei um livro, li um monte de tutoriais e etc....mas sinto muita dificuldade em relacionar meus conhecimentos na linguagem. Tenho dificuldades em montar um sistema em php, ou melhor, só consigo no dreamweaver. Não quero ficar copiando e colando códigos, quero aprender a construir. Por isso gostaria de saber o que vocês indicam...

    Obrigado mais uma vez a ajuda!!! smile.gif

  7. Tou contruindo um sistema em PHP de uma imobiliaria. Esse sistema tem um banco de dados MySql, um formulário de inclusão de dados no banco(codigo_imovel, tipo_imovel, cidade, bairro, foto...) que quando incluo esses dados o arquivo da foto vai para uma pasta no servidor. E tem algumas páginas que exibem os dados. E eu estou enfrentando alguns problemas, como eunão consigo fazer com que a foto a qual o nome foi inserido no banco seja exibida.

    Eu utilizo o dreamweaver mx 2004.

    Se possível gostaria de receber uma resposta urgente... rolleyes.gif

    Valeu mesmo!

    Um abraço

  8. huh.gif

    Ae pessoal, tou com um problema no dreamweaver, quando eu abro um arquivo PHP e tento fazer uma conexão com um banco de dados MySql, dá um problema. Ou seja eu vou na janela banco de dados na conexões, clico no botão mais para desenvolver uma nova conexão, aberta a janela eu coloco descrição, servidor, nome, senha, tudo. Porém quando eu vou selecionar o banco de dados MySql da um erro não definido.

    Gostaria que me ajudassem poistenho que entragar um projeto urgente!

    Valeu mesmo!

    rolleyes.gif

  9. Preciso montar uma página de acesso a um banco de dados do access, já tentei vários códigos porém não tenho êxito, não tenho muito conhecimento em programação, preciso de um código urgente, o banco tem mais ou menos 37 campos, eu preciso fazer uma página de inserção de dados, remoção e de pesquisa...

    Valeu... ohmy.gif

×
×
  • Criar Novo...